Darya Straltsova is a scholar working on Plant Science, Molecular Biology and Biomedical Engineering. According to data from OpenAlex, Darya Straltsova has authored 8 papers receiving a total of 855 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Plant Science, 2 papers in Molecular Biology and 2 papers in Biomedical Engineering. Recurrent topics in Darya Straltsova's work include Plant Stress Responses and Tolerance (5 papers), Plant Molecular Biology Research (2 papers) and Marine Sponges and Natural Products (1 paper). Darya Straltsova is often cited by papers focused on Plant Stress Responses and Tolerance (5 papers), Plant Molecular Biology Research (2 papers) and Marine Sponges and Natural Products (1 paper). Darya Straltsova collaborates with scholars based in Belarus, United Kingdom and Russia. Darya Straltsova's co-authors include Vadim Demidchik, А. И. Соколик, Vladimir Yurin, С.С. Медведев, Dimitri A. Svistunenko, David P. Anderson, Vladimir B. Golovko, Tracy Lawson, I. Colbeck and Elena V. Tyutereva and has published in prestigious journals such as The Plant Journal, Journal of Experimental Botany and Frontiers in Plant Science.
